Expression -- Description ? help Back to Top
Source Description
UniprotTISSUE SPECIFICITY: Expressed in a band of cells at the adaxial base of all lateral organs formed from the shoot apical meristem and at the base of lateral roots. {ECO:0000269|PubMed:12068116}.
Functional Description ? help Back to Top
Source Description
UniProtNot known; ectopic expression of LOB leads to alterations in the size and shape of leaves and floral organs and causes male and female sterility.

Regulation -- Description ? help Back to Top
Source Description
UniProtINDUCTION: Positively regulated within the shoot apex by both ASYMMETRIC LEAVES 1 (AS1) and ASYMMETRIC LEAVES 2 (AS2/LBD6) and by KNAT1. {ECO:0000269|PubMed:11934861}.
